What's in the feed now

Tax year 2021 — took in $115,661 more than it spent. Revenue $500,160 · expenses $384,499 · reserve months 66.8
Tax year 2020 — took in $125,896 more than it spent. Revenue $544,378 · expenses $418,482 · reserve months 57.2
Tax year 2019 — took in $68,362 more than it spent. Revenue $684,882 · expenses $616,520 · reserve months 37.8
Tax year 2018 — took in $97,588 more than it spent. Revenue $568,980 · expenses $471,392 · reserve months 46.7
Tax year 2017 — took in $69,920 more than it spent. Revenue $532,835 · expenses $462,915 · reserve months 47.3
Tax year 2016 — took in $13,011 more than it spent. Revenue $530,279 · expenses $517,268 · reserve months 40.4
Tax year 2015 — took in $23,251 more than it spent. Revenue $501,635 · expenses $478,384 · reserve months 41.6
Tax year 2014 — spent $36,583 more than it took in. Revenue $441,512 · expenses $478,095 · reserve months 43.0
Tax year 2012 — took in $4,734 more than it spent. Revenue $382,517 · expenses $377,783 · reserve months 52.3
Tax year 2011 — took in $40,089 more than it spent. Revenue $336,789 · expenses $296,700 · reserve months 65.4
